Ken Saville, M.S. student in the Department of Earth & Environmental Sciences will discuss his work as a Food Safety Inspector. His experience is especially relevant to those in the Environmental Heath Sciences degree program, but also more broadly as it demonstrates the unexpected challenges that arise in many fields and the value of creativity in solving problems.
